Combustion typically has a Fuel and an Oxidizer.
Typically the oxidizer is Oxygen in the elemental form O2, but it can be other substances such as potassium nitrate or ammonium perchlorate which are often used in rocket fuels in the absences of air.
The fuel can be any hydrocarbon source such as wood, oil, coal, alcohol, etc. Or any
reducing substance that reacts with the oxidizer above.
Two other components would be an activation energy (the energy required to initiate the reaction) and a requirement for an exothermic reaction (a chemical reaction that releases heat or energy).
I.E. Wood and air are fine together... until you light a match.
